如何在 Windows Server 2003 的工作组中安装和配置 DHCP 服务器

文章翻译 文章翻译
文章编号: 323416 - 查看本文应用于的产品
展开全部 | 关闭全部

本文内容

概要

本文分步介绍了如何在独立服务器上配置一台基于 Windows Server 2003 的新的动态主机配置协议 (DHCP) 服务器,以便为网络上的客户端计算机提供对 IP 地址和其他 TCP/IP 配置设置的集中化管理。

如何安装 DHCP 服务

配置 DHCP 服务之前,必须先将其安装到服务器上。在 Windows Standard Server 2003 或 Windows Enterprise Server 2003 的典型安装过程中,不会默认安装 DHCP。您可以在 Windows Server 2003 的初始安装期间或在初始安装完成后安装 DHCP。

如何在现有的服务器上安装 DHCP 服务

  1. 单击开始,指向控制面板,然后单击“添加或删除程序”。
  2. 在“添加或删除程序”对话框中,单击添加/删除 Windows 组件
  3. 在 Windows 组件向导中,单击组件列表中的网络服务,然后单击详细信息
  4. 网络服务对话框中,单击以选中“动态主机配置协议(DHCP)”复选框,然后单击确定
  5. 在 Windows 组件向导中,单击下一步,启动安装程序。出现提示时,将 Windows Server 2003 CD-ROM 插入计算机的 CD-ROM 或者 DVD-ROM 驱动器。安装程序会将 DHCP 服务器和工具文件复制到计算机上。
  6. 完成安装后,单击完成

如何配置 DHCP 服务

安装好 DHCP 服务并启动后,必须创建一个作用域,该作用域是可供网络中的 DHCP 客户端租用的有效 IP 地址的范围。Microsoft 建议环境中的每个 DHCP 服务器至少应有一个作用域不与环境中的任何其他 DHCP 服务器作用域相重叠。在 Windows Server 2003 中,必须向基于 Active Directory 的域中的 DHCP 服务器授权才能防止 rogue DHCP 服务器联机。确定自己未被授权的任何 Windows Server 2003 DHCP 服务器不能管理客户端。

如何创建新作用域

  1. 单击开始,指向程序,指向管理工具,然后单击 DHCP
  2. 在控制台树中,右键单击要在其上创建新 DHCP 作用域的 DHCP 服务器,然后单击新作用域
  3. 在“新作用域向导”中,单击下一步,然后键入该作用域的名称及说明。名称可以随您的意愿而定,但它应具备一定的说明性,以便您能确定该作用域在网络中的作用(例如,您可以使用“Administration Building Client Addresses”这样的名称)。单击下一步
  4. 键入可作为该作用域的一部分租用的地址范围(例如,可使用这样的 IP 地址范围:起始 IP 地址为 192.168.100.1,结束地址为 192.168.100.100)。因为这些地址将提供给客户端,所以它们对于您的网络来说必须是有效的,并且当前未在使用。如果要使用其他子网掩码,请键入新的子网掩码。单击下一步
  5. 键入要从所输入范围中排除的任何 IP 地址。这包括步骤 4 中说明的地址范围中已静态分配给组织中各个计算机的所有地址。通常情况下,域控制器、Web 服务器、DHCP 服务器、域名系统 (DNS) 服务器和其他服务器均已静态分配了 IP 地址。单击下一步
  6. 键入该作用域的 IP 地址租用到期之前的天数、小时数和分钟数。这将确定客户端可持有租用地址而不用续租的时间长短。单击下一步,然后单击“是,我想现在配置这些选项”,以将向导扩展到包括最常见 DHCP 选项的设置。单击下一步
  7. 键入默认网关的 IP 地址,从作用域获得 IP 地址的客户端将使用此 IP 地址。单击添加以将默认网关地址添加到列表中,然后单击下一步
  8. 如果在网络中使用 DNS 服务器,则在“父域”框中键入您的组织的域名。键入 DNS 服务器的名称,然后单击解析,以确保 DHCP 服务器能与 DNS 服务器联系并确定其地址。单击添加,将该服务器添加到指定给 DHCP 客户端的 DNS 服务器列表中。单击下一步,如果使用的是 Windows Internet 命名服务 (WINS) 服务器,则按照相同的步骤添加服务器名称和 IP 地址。单击下一步
  9. 单击“是,我想现在激活此作用域”,以激活该作用域并允许客户端从该作用域获得租用,然后单击下一步
  10. 单击完成
  11. 在控制台树中,单击该服务器名称,然后单击操作菜单上的授权

疑难解答

以下各节介绍如何解决在工作组中尝试安装和配置基于 Windows Server 2003 的 DHCP 服务器时可能会遇到的一些问题。

客户端无法获得 IP 地址

如果 DHCP 客户端没有已配置的 IP 地址,这通常说明该客户端无法联系 DHCP 服务器。这可能由网络问题导致,也可能因为 DHCP 服务器不可用。如果 DHCP 服务器启动并且其他客户端可获得有效地址,请检查该客户端是否具备有效的网络连接,以及所有相关客户端硬件设备(包括电缆和网络适配器)是否工作正常。

DHCP 服务器不可用

如果 DHCP 服务器不向客户端提供租用地址,常常是由于 DHCP 服务未启动。如果是这种情况,则可能未授权该服务器在网络上运行。如果您以前能够启动 DHCP 服务,但是现在一直停止,则应使用事件查看器检查系统日志中可能解释其原因的所有条目。

要重新启动 DHCP 服务,请执行下列操作:
  1. 单击开始,然后单击运行
  2. 键入 cmd,然后按 Enter。
  3. 键入 net start dhcpserver,然后按 Enter。
- 或 -
  1. 单击开始,指向控制面板,指向管理工具,然后单击计算机管理
  2. 展开“服务和应用程序”,然后单击服务
  3. 找到并双击 DHCP 服务器
  4. 确保启动类型设置为自动服务状态设置为已启动。如果不是,请单击启动
  5. 单击确定,然后关闭“计算机管理”窗口。

参考

有关 Windows Server 2003 中的 DHCP 的其他信息,请单击下面的文章编号,以查看 Microsoft 知识库中相应的文章:
169289 DHCP(动态主机配置协议)基本信息
167014 DHCP 客户端可能无法获取已分配 DHCP 的 IP 地址
133490 解决 DHCP 网络上的重复 IP 地址冲突
263217 Windows DHCP 服务器将不正确的设置传递给默认网关或 DNS 服务器

属性

文章编号: 323416 - 最后修改: 2007年12月3日 - 修订: 7.3
这篇文章中的信息适用于:
  • Microsoft Windows Server 2003 Enterprise Edition
  • Microsoft Windows Server 2003 Standard Edition
  • Microsoft Windows Small Business Server 2003 Premium Edition
  • Microsoft Windows Small Business Server 2003 Standard Edition
关键字:?
kbhowto kbhowtomaster kbnetwork KB323416
Microsoft和/或其各供应商对于为任何目的而在本服务器上发布的文件及有关图形所含信息的适用性,不作任何声明。 所有该等文件及有关图形均"依样"提供,而不带任何性质的保证。Microsoft和/或其各供应商特此声明,对所有与该等信息有关的保证和条件不负任何责任,该等保证和条件包括关于适销性、符合特定用途、所有权和非侵权的所有默示保证和条件。在任何情况下,在由于使用或运行本服务器上的信息所引起的或与该等使用或运行有关的诉讼中,Microsoft和/或其各供应商就因丧失使用、数据或利润所导致的任何特别的、间接的、衍生性的损害或任何因使用而丧失所导致的之损害、数据或利润不负任何责任。

提供反馈

 

Contact us for more help

Contact us for more help
Connect with Answer Desk for expert help.
Get more support from smallbusiness.support.microsoft.com